Sourdough as being a Nutritional Powerhouse
Sourdough bread, in contrast, is frequently celebrated for its nutritional benefits. Manufactured by way of a normal fermentation process, sourdough features a lessen glycemic index when compared to other breads, this means it has a slower impact on blood sugar stages. This causes it to be an even better choice for retaining Strength stages through the entire university working day.

Furthermore, the fermentation process in sourdough breaks down several of the gluten and phytic acid from the flour, making it simpler to digest and maximizing the bioavailability of nutrients like magnesium, iron, and zinc. This positions sourdough for a nutritious selection for college meals, especially when produced with entire grains.

The Accessibility of Sourdough: Cost and Preparing Challenges
Whilst sourdough gives many well being benefits, its integration into school food systems will not be with no troubles. 1 substantial barrier is Expense. Sourdough bread, notably when made with high-high quality, natural and organic elements, might be more expensive than commercially developed bread. This makes it complicated for universities, Primarily People with limited budgets, สถานที่เรียนทำอาหาร to provide sourdough regularly.

A different problem is preparation. Sourdough demands a for a longer time fermentation process, which can be challenging to manage in a college kitchen area. Some faculties have resolved this by partnering with community bakeries, but this Answer might not be possible in all spots.
